Kevon Nuby Accident; Early Morning Crash Claims Life Of 24-Year-Old Kevon Nuby

A fatal crash in Camp Washington early Sunday morning claimed the life of Kevon Javell Nuby, a 24-year-old man from Reading. The tragic incident occurred at approximately 6:24 a.m. on Spring Grove Avenue, near Hopple Street. According to a news release from the Cincinnati Police Department, Nuby was driving north on Spring Grove Avenue when his car veered off the road at a bend, striking both a fire hydrant and a utility pole.

The Hamilton County Coroner’s Office confirmed Nuby’s identity in a report released on Tuesday morning. Despite the Cincinnati Fire Department’s efforts to save him, Nuby was pronounced dead at the scene.

The police are investigating whether excessive speed and impairment were factors in the crash. They noted that Nuby was not wearing a seatbelt at the time of the incident.

The Cincinnati Police Department’s Traffic Unit is seeking any witnesses to the crash and has urged them to come forward with information by contacting 513-352-2514. The investigation remains ongoing as authorities work to determine the exact circumstances that led to the fatal accident.
